Footnotes
BLESSED FLYER chased forwardly in the two to three path, brushed with an inner foe entering the lane, picked up stride after shifting four wide in upper stretch, rallied five wide into the final furlong, ranged up to bid outside of the leader at the sixteenth pole and wore that one down late. SUPER SAIYAJIN raced close up along the inside, tipped to the three path to take aim outside of the leader at the five sixteenths pole, shifted inwardly to inherit an advantage from that injured foe nearing the furlong grounds, got collared by an outer challenger passing the sixteenth pole and was bested late. MR GERSON bumped with an outer rival then an inner foe at the tart, pursued from the two path, then between horses turning for home, brushed with an outer rival entering the lane, swerved to avoid an injured foe while bidding for place among rivals at the furlong grounds, but got outkicked then held show. CASTLE PINES broke a step slow, lacked speed in the three path, shifted out to the six path entering the lane, stayed on willingy to move up between horses late but missed show at the wire. AMERICAN POPE raced off of the pace in the five path, floated out to the seven to eight path entering the lane, stayed on mildly outside of foes and missed fourth. GRANDES SUENOS raced close up in the three to four path, chased while lugging in three wide and between horses at the three sixteenths pole, got outkicked while subtly put in tight in midstretch then yielded while continuing to hang on his left lead. PAPER RUN broke inwardly and bumped a rival while off slow, saved ground off of the pace, inched closer turning for home then stayed on mildly while hanging on his left lead. PERFECT MO broke awkwardly and was off slow, trailed along the inside and failed to factor. TRIM CASTLE bumped with an inner rival at the start, pursued from the four path, lugged inwardly while hanging on his left lead in upper stretch, ran in his injured stablemate leaving the furlong grounds, was eased thereafter, crossed the wire then walked off. SING FOR MO MONEY took contact from a pair of outer rivals at the start, set the pace in the two path, but sustained an injury in upper stretch, was bumped behind while pulling up leaving the furlong grounds then was transported off of the track in an equine ambulance.
